How to order Starbucks’ Sunflower drink
Want to get your hands on Starbucks’ Sunflower drink? Luckily, @lisbontarbucks shared how to order.
According to the TikTok account, you simply ask your barista for lemonade with raspberry syrup, topped off with passion tea. It’s that easy.
The employees also commented: “Each Starbucks store is different and comes up with different names/drinks, this is a custom to our store. Please use the ‘how to order” for others.”
